QueueTide autoscaler images must be built from the locked manifest; reviewers should reject any PR that bumps scaling libraries without a provenance note. Check that the attestation chain covers the depth-sampler binary, not just the controller. Unsigned artifacts never reach staging. When approving, confirm the release candidate by the token below.

build token for kagaf-hahof: htk14_9d3d4d26d7d8de

## Ticket: FW-4182 — Expired credentials on firmware channel

The Emberline device fleet stopped receiving firmware updates last night. Root cause: the publishing credential for the `stable-firmware` channel expired and nobody rotated it. Devices are fine — they just poll and get nothing new. To restore publishing, update the channel config in the Pushgate console and redeploy the release worker. Note for new folks: this happens roughly yearly, so set a reminder next time. The replacement credential for the Pushgate internal API is below.

service key, fawip-bajef: kto11_Qt5wZK9vdNC

Handover — Socketry compression

We run permessage-deflate on Socketry but only for payloads >1 KB; below that, compression costs more CPU than it saves. Watch node memory — context takeover is on, so long-lived connections hold deflate windows. If memory alarms fire, flip to no-context-takeover and expect ~8% more bandwidth. Don't raise the compression level past 4; we tried 6 and latency spiked. Current production values are as follows.

deployment values, yadug-bawif:
[framir]
team = pelox
access_code = ac_a38ab2
owner = tamion.julael
host = framir.tolvaqlabs.test
port = 11211
peer = tammir.zemvargrid.local
salt = 2215ef03
pin = 1541

# LinkLatch Environments

LinkLatch routes mobile deep links across three environments: dev, staging, and prod. Dev uses synthetic route tables; staging mirrors prod routing with a one-hour sync lag; prod serves live traffic behind the Orvane edge. For the weekly sync, note that staging's current configuration values are these.

service settings:
pelath:
  pin: 5871
  tenant: belox
  seal: seal_d5a7bfb2
  metrics_host: metrics.pelath.qorvelcorp.test
  standby_team: oliys
  escalation: kelath-nordor
  nonce: 338058